The Certificate in Relationship Management in Healthcare is a specialized program designed to equip healthcare professionals with the skills and knowledge necessary to effectively manage patient relationships and improve healthcare outcomes.
This program focuses on teaching participants how to build strong relationships with patients, families, and healthcare teams, which is essential for delivering high-quality patient care and achieving better health outcomes.
Through a combination of theoretical and practical training, participants will learn how to assess patient needs, develop personalized care plans, and communicate effectively with patients and families to ensure their needs are met.
The program covers topics such as patient-centered care, cultural competence, and communication skills, as well as strategies for managing conflict and improving patient satisfaction.
Upon completion of the program, participants will be able to apply their knowledge and skills to improve patient relationships and healthcare outcomes in a variety of healthcare settings, including hospitals, clinics, and community health organizations.

Course content


• Communication Skills in Healthcare
• Patient-Centred Care
• Relationship Building in Healthcare
• Conflict Resolution in Healthcare
• Emotional Intelligence in Healthcare
• Cultural Competence in Healthcare
• Effective Listening Skills
• Empathy and Compassion in Healthcare
• Teamwork and Collaboration in Healthcare
• Quality Improvement in Healthcare


Assessments

The assessment process primarily relies on the submission of assignments, and it does not involve any written examinations or direct observations.
